So I drove up to meet TMAck yesterday after work and pick up a 'set' that he built for me. :thanks: I spent over 4 hours 'playing' in his living room! haha...

Awesome guy, lots of knowledge, and some *very* cool toys... :D

So my setup includes: 4 custom built 501b hosts, color coordinated (or pretty damn close to) the appropriate wavelength, good quality cells to run them all, a snazzy 'smart' charger, and a nice padded case to carry everything in! And as you can see, the case is big enough to carry my only other laser (a funky looking chinese 445), my LaserBee LPM, spare batts, etc... it all fits nice n' snug.

I've got the specs in an email somewhere... Perhaps TMack will see this thread and chime in if he remembers... I know the 445nm came in at 2.7-2.8W, the 405nm was around 950mW, and the 520nm might have been around 180-185mW? I don't recall on the 638nm... Maybe 500mW...
